MOD085 – Kampo Medicine

Kampo medicine is a traditional Japanese system of herbal medicine derived from ancient Chinese medicine, integrated into Japan’s national healthcare system. It uses standardised herbal formulas to restore balance and promote overall health and well-being.

MOD088 – Light Therapy

Light therapy, also called phototherapy or bright light therapy, is a non-invasive treatment that uses controlled exposure to specific wavelengths of artificial light to address various health conditions and promote overall wellbeing.

MOD090 – Craniosacral Therapy

Craniosacral therapy (CST) is a gentle, hands-on approach that aims to enhance the body’s natural capacity for self-regulation and healing by addressing the craniosacral system – the membranes and fluid surrounding the brain and spinal cord. It involves light touch and subtle manipulations to assess and release restrictions in this system.

MOD091 – Gua Sha

Gua Sha is a traditional Chinese healing technique that involves scraping the skin with a smooth-edged tool to promote circulation, release tension, and stimulate the body’s natural healing processes.

MOD092 – Hydrotherm Massage

Hydrotherm Massage is a therapeutic massage technique performed with the client lying comfortably on warm water-filled cushions, allowing for a deeply relaxing and nurturing experience. This method provides a unique, weightless sensation that supports the body and enhances the overall effectiveness of the massage.
